Based on 105 recent sales, the median property price is £347,500 (about £432 per square foot) in Cage Green & Angel area, with individual transactions ranging from £57,750 up to £2,350,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 18 | £889,000 | £530 |
| Semi-Detached | 24 | £425,500 | £467 |
| Terraced | 15 | £385,000 | £409 |
| Flats | 48 | £262,500 | £381 |

Postcode TN9 1PD is located in an urban city, within the Cage Green & Angel ward of Tonbridge and Malling in the South East region, and forms part of the Tonbridge Higham Wood area. It has low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 19.7 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 77% below the South East average of 84 per 1,000. The average income per household in Tonbridge Higham Wood is £68,910 per year. The nearest station is Tonbridge, about 1.1 miles away. There are 4 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area.
Tonbridge Higham Wood has a low level of deprivation, ranked at position 24,313 out of 32,844 areas in England, placing it within the bottom 26% least deprived areas in England.
Tonbridge Higham Wood has a very low crime rate, with approximately 19.7 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.
Approximately 15.4%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 20.9% of dwellings are socially rented.
